摘要
ALFA (Adaptive Optics with Laser for Astronomy) is a joint project between the Max Planck Institut fur extraterrestrische Physik in Garching and the Max Planck Institut fur Astronomie in Heidelberg. To increase the sky coverage of the adaptive optics system we are using a laser guide star that is created in the sodium layer of the earth atmosophere. The laser consists of a 5W cw dye laser, operated at single frequency and tuned to the sodium D-2 resonance transition. Here we report on the present status of the laser system, the technological means to ensure an easy operation of the laser guide star, as well as on developments we are planning for the future.
